I think this is it right now:

  • NBCSN, Peacock:  English Premier League
  • BEIN:  Spanish La Liga, French Lique 1
  • CBS/Paramount+:  UEFA Champion's League, UEFA Europa League, Brazilian Serie A, Argentine Primera Division
  • ESPN+:  German Bundesliga, Italian Serie A, MLS, English FA Cup, English Championship
